The effect of mere-measurement of cognitions on physical activity behavior: a randomized controlled trial among overweight and obese individuals.
The international journal of behavioral nutrition and physical activity - 11 Jan 2011
Godin Gaston, Bélanger-Gravel Ariane, Amireault Steve, Vohl Marie-Claude, Pérusse Louis
Abstract excerpt
BACKGROUND: The promotion of physical activity among an overweight/obese population is an important challenge for clinical practitioners and researchers. In this regard, completing a questionnaire on cognitions could be a simple and easy strategy to increase levels of physical activity. Thus, the aim of the present study was to test the effect of completing a questionnaire based on the Theory of Planned Behavior...
